The LB 134 Universal Monitor II can be used to measure radioactive alpha and beta/gamma contamination, to determine activity, and to determine gamma and neutron dose rates under environmental equivalent dose and dose rate H * (10) parameters. Therefore, a large number of different detectors can be connected to the basic unit. By integrating Geiger-M ü ller counter tubes, gamma dose rates can be measured without connecting additional external detectors.
Product Introduction of Berthold LB134 Radiation Monitor from Germany:
LB134 Host Product Information
LB134 universal display with built-in dose rate detector instrument
Display: Monochrome LCD 192 x 64 pixel electroluminescent lighting
Gamma radiation detector: Geiger-M ü ller tube [built-in]
Measurement modes: speedometer, calibrator, search, mode
External dimensions: 160 mm (L) x 160 mm (W) x 55 mm (D)
Weight: 1400 grams (including battery)
Data storage: 2400 measurement values with date and time
Communication: USB, USB drive host, RS 4851
Large operating time: 15 hours alkaline battery 2.6 Ah
>10 hour nickel hydrogen rechargeable battery 1.9 Ah [internal detector activity]

Gamma radiation detector
Dose range: 0.1 μ Sv/h to 20 mSv/h
Energy range: 50 keV to 1.3 MeV
Calibration factor: 0.625 μ Sv/h per CPS Cs-137
Background: Approximately 0.07 CPS

(LB 123 D-H10) Dose Rate Detector
Detector type: Energy compensated proportional counter tube
Measurement range: 50 nSv/h -10 mSv/h
Energy response range: 30 keV – 1.3 MeV
Background background value:<0.1 CPS
Calibration factor: 0.214 μ Sv/h per CPS
Specification: 50 mm x 275 mm
Weight: 0.46kg
Protection level: IP65
Working environment: -20 ° C~+60 ° C
